From 020a4d6dccfa25235a1481efc3e449a73a0d659a Mon Sep 17 00:00:00 2001
From: James Moger <james.moger@gitblit.com>
Date: Thu, 24 Oct 2013 08:12:03 -0400
Subject: [PATCH] Merge pull request #119 from simonharrer/fix-locale-test-run-bug
---
src/main/java/WEB-INF/web.xml | 54 ++++++++++++++++++++++++++++++++++++++++++++++++------
1 files changed, 48 insertions(+), 6 deletions(-)
diff --git a/src/main/java/WEB-INF/web.xml b/src/main/java/WEB-INF/web.xml
index 5ee5ed2..6e24326 100644
--- a/src/main/java/WEB-INF/web.xml
+++ b/src/main/java/WEB-INF/web.xml
@@ -22,10 +22,12 @@
review the defaults for any new settings. Settings are always versioned
with a SINCE x.y.z attribute and also noted in the release changelog.
-->
- <context-param>
- <param-name>baseFolder</param-name>
- <param-value>${contextFolder}/WEB-INF/data</param-value>
- </context-param>
+ <env-entry>
+ <description>The base folder is used to specify the root location of your Gitblit data.</description>
+ <env-entry-name>baseFolder</env-entry-name>
+ <env-entry-type>java.lang.String</env-entry-type>
+ <env-entry-value>${contextFolder}/WEB-INF/data</env-entry-value>
+ </env-entry>
<!-- Gitblit Displayname -->
<display-name>
@@ -53,7 +55,21 @@
<servlet-name>GitServlet</servlet-name>
<url-pattern>/git/*</url-pattern>
</servlet-mapping>
+
+ <!-- SparkleShare Invite Servlet
+ <url-pattern> MUST match:
+ * com.gitblit.Constants.SPARKLESHARE_INVITE_PATH
+ * Wicket Filter ignorePaths parameter -->
+ <servlet>
+ <servlet-name>SparkleShareInviteServlet</servlet-name>
+ <servlet-class>com.gitblit.SparkleShareInviteServlet</servlet-class>
+ </servlet>
+ <servlet-mapping>
+ <servlet-name>SparkleShareInviteServlet</servlet-name>
+ <url-pattern>/sparkleshare/*</url-pattern>
+ </servlet-mapping>
+
<!-- Syndication Servlet
<url-pattern> MUST match:
@@ -126,7 +142,31 @@
<servlet-name>PagesServlet</servlet-name>
<url-pattern>/pages/*</url-pattern>
</servlet-mapping>
+
+ <!-- Logo Servlet
+ <url-pattern> MUST match:
+ * Wicket Filter ignorePaths parameter -->
+ <servlet>
+ <servlet-name>LogoServlet</servlet-name>
+ <servlet-class>com.gitblit.LogoServlet</servlet-class>
+ </servlet>
+ <servlet-mapping>
+ <servlet-name>LogoServlet</servlet-name>
+ <url-pattern>/logo.png</url-pattern>
+ </servlet-mapping>
+
+ <!-- Branch Graph Servlet
+ <url-pattern> MUST match:
+ * Wicket Filter ignorePaths parameter -->
+ <servlet>
+ <servlet-name>BranchGraphServlet</servlet-name>
+ <servlet-class>com.gitblit.BranchGraphServlet</servlet-class>
+ </servlet>
+ <servlet-mapping>
+ <servlet-name>BranchGraphServlet</servlet-name>
+ <url-pattern>/graph/*</url-pattern>
+ </servlet-mapping>
<!-- Robots.txt Servlet
<url-pattern> MUST match:
@@ -229,7 +269,7 @@
<filter>
<filter-name>wicketFilter</filter-name>
<filter-class>
- org.apache.wicket.protocol.http.WicketFilter
+ com.gitblit.wicket.GitblitWicketFilter
</filter-class>
<init-param>
<param-name>applicationClassName</param-name>
@@ -244,6 +284,8 @@
* GitFilter <url-pattern>
* GitServlet <url-pattern>
* com.gitblit.Constants.GIT_PATH
+ * SparkleshareInviteServlet <url-pattern>
+ * com.gitblit.Constants.SPARKLESHARE_INVITE_PATH
* Zipfilter <url-pattern>
* ZipServlet <url-pattern>
* com.gitblit.Constants.ZIP_PATH
@@ -253,7 +295,7 @@
* PagesFilter <url-pattern>
* PagesServlet <url-pattern>
* com.gitblit.Constants.PAGES_PATH -->
- <param-value>git/,feed/,zip/,federation/,rpc/,pages/,robots.txt</param-value>
+ <param-value>git/,feed/,zip/,federation/,rpc/,pages/,robots.txt,logo.png,graph/,sparkleshare/</param-value>
</init-param>
</filter>
<filter-mapping>
--
Gitblit v1.9.1